How to fill out chemistry chemistry unit 3

How to Fill Out Chemistry Chemistry Unit 3:
01
Review the materials: Before starting to fill out the unit, it's essential to review the materials provided for Chemistry Unit 3. Go through the textbook, lecture notes, and any additional resources that may have been given.
02
Understand the learning objectives: Familiarize yourself with the learning objectives outlined for Chemistry Unit 3. These objectives will serve as a guide to help you stay focused and comprehend the key concepts covered in this unit.
03
Read the instructions carefully: Read the instructions for each task or assignment related to Chemistry Unit 3 thoroughly. Make sure you understand what is expected from you and any specific guidelines or formatting requirements.
04
Gather necessary resources: Collect all the resources you may need to complete the unit. This includes textbooks, notebooks, online resources, calculators, periodic tables, or any other materials specified in the instructions.
05
Take notes: As you work through the unit, take detailed notes on important concepts, formulas, and any other crucial information. These notes will serve as valuable study material later on.
06
Complete the assignments: Start working on the assignments or tasks related to Chemistry Unit 3. Follow the instructions provided and answer the questions to the best of your knowledge. If you come across any difficulties, don't hesitate to seek assistance from your teacher or classmates.
07
Double-check your work: Once you have completed the unit, go back and review your answers and solutions. Check for any errors, ensure you have followed all instructions, and make any necessary edits or corrections. Pay attention to details such as units, significant figures, and proper labeling.
08
Seek feedback: If possible, ask your teacher or peers to review your work and provide feedback. This feedback will help you identify areas that need improvement and understand any mistakes you may have made.
